要将ChatGPT改为中文,需要进行以下步骤:
- 数据收集:收集用于训练ChatGPT模型的中文对话数据。可以使用公开可用的聊天数据集,或者自己创建一个对话数据集。
- 数据预处理:对收集的中文对话数据进行预处理,包括分词、去除停用词、标记化等。可以使用开源的中文NLP工具,如jieba分词库。
- 构建训练集:将预处理后的中文对话数据转换为模型可以接受的格式,通常是将输入和输出对应起来,并转换为数字化表示。可以使用标记化技术,如将每个词转换为对应的ID。
- 训练模型:使用预处理后的中文对话数据训练ChatGPT模型。可以使用现有的GPT模型实现,如OpenAI的GPT-2或GPT-3,通过微调(fine-tuning)来适应中文对话数据。
- 评估和调优:对训练得到的模型进行评估和调优,确保其在中文对话任务上有较好的性能。可以使用一些指标,如困惑度(perplexity)或人工评估来评估模型的质量。
- 部署模型:将训练好的中文ChatGPT模型部署到一个可用的服务或应用中,以便用户可以与其交互。可以使用现有的Chatbot平台或自己构建一个简单的前端界面。
以上是将ChatGPT改为中文的一般步骤,具体实施过程可能会因应用场景和需求的不同而有所差异。
要将ChatGPT转换为中文,可以采取以下步骤:
- 数据收集:收集用于训练中文ChatGPT的大量中文对话数据。这可以包括聊天记录、对话语料库、社交媒体数据等。
- 数据预处理:使用适当的工具和技术对收集到的中文数据进行预处理。这包括分词、标记化、去除停用词和特殊字符等。
- 模型训练:使用预处理后的中文数据集训练ChatGPT模型。这可以使用类似于英文ChatGPT的训练流程,但需要将数据和模型设置为处理中文。
- 中文语言模型:在训练过程中,确保选择适当的中文语言模型作为基础模型。这可以是类似于GPT的中文语言模型,也可以是其他已经在中文上训练过的模型。
- 评估和微调:评估训练好的中文ChatGPT模型的性能,并根据需要进行微调。这可以通过与人类对话进行比较、计算指标(如BLEU、Perplexity)等来完成。
- 部署和测试:将训练好的中文ChatGPT模型部署到适当的平台上,并进行测试和调试,以确保它在与用户进行中文对话时能够正常工作。
需要注意的是,将ChatGPT转换为中文可能需要更多的数据和计算资源。此外,中文的语法和句法结构与英文有所不同,因此在训练和微调过程中要仔细处理和调整相应的设置。
chatgpt如何改成中文 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/9630/